Cherial Mandal - Siddipet, Telangana

Cherial is an administrative mandal in the Siddipet district of Telangana, India. It includes various villages governed through Gram Panchayats and forms part of the district's rural administration. The nearest railway station is situated at Jangaon, while the nearest airport is Warangal Airport, located at an approximate aerial distance of 54.1 km.

According to the 2011 Census, the total area of the mandal was 311 km². The sex ratio was 995 females per 1,000 males.

Population of Cherial Mandal

According to the 2011 Census, Cherial Mandal had a total population of 70,809 people living in 16,287 households. The population comprised 35,499 males and 35,310 females, with an average population density of 228 people per km². The table below provides a rural-urban comparison of these statistics.
